Data Analysis and Business Intelligence
A practical path into analytics starts with cleaning data, then turning it into visual stories. As a data analyst, you will pull messy datasets, clean them, and use stats and charts to reveal trends for retail, social media, or other business teams.
Tools for Data Insights
Focus on a short, hands-on course of three to six months to gain the core skills. Learn Excel basics, SQL queries, and Python scripting. Add BI tools like Power BI to present metrics clearly.
Build a portfolio by analyzing public datasets from Kaggle or data.gov. Show projects that solve business questions and include clear dashboards.
Your technical mastery will help bridge raw information and strategic needs. Equally important is the ability to explain findings to non-technical people so companies can act on your work and hire you for your first data analyst job.
Cybersecurity and Network Defense
A career in network defense trains you to spot threats, contain incidents, and protect sensitive data.
Cybersecurity specialists act as digital bodyguards for companies, guarding networks from breaches and ransomware. You monitor systems, scan for suspicious activity, and respond to security issues before they spread.
You can launch this career through a reputable bootcamp that includes hands-on labs for threat detection and incident response. Earning CompTIA Security+ boosts your résumé and proves foundational knowledge to hiring managers.
In this role you need creative problem-solving and clear communication. Analysts document incidents, coordinate with other teams, and help design stronger defenses for finance, healthcare, and other sectors.
Practical tip: build small projects that show your tools and processes. Real labs and SOC-style exercises give you the experience companies want when you apply for your first security job.
Software Development and Engineering
Entry-level software work often centers on writing clear code, fixing bugs, and shipping features that real users rely on. Full-stack developers who handle both front-end and back-end logic are especially valuable to companies that need robust web presences.
Front End Development
Front end work turns design mockups into responsive websites and user interfaces. You will learn to make pages that load fast and work across browsers.
Key skills: HTML, CSS, JavaScript, React. Focus on accessibility, performance, and user testing.
Back End Logic
Back end work handles data, APIs, and systems that keep applications running. Languages like Python, Java, or Node.js power server-side features and databases.
How to prove your ability: build two or three projects and host them on GitHub. Show a full-stack app or an API, include tests, and document deployment steps.
Collaboration matters: use Git well, communicate with teammates, and learn basic testing to resolve issues faster and support product development.

Quality Assurance and Testing
QA work helps teams ship better web and software by catching issues early.
What you do: you write and run test cases that reveal bugs and confirm systems behave as expected. Clear reports and step-by-step reproduction make it faster for development teams to fix problems.
Manual vs Automated Testing
Start with manual testing to learn how users interact with products and how to design atypical test scenarios.
Then add automation using tools like Selenium or Cypress to scale repetitive checks. Automated suites boost efficiency and improve product quality across releases.
Skill growth: learn SQL and Jira to validate data and track issues. Your communication and methodical approach will help you move from a QA analyst to an automation engineer or other testing roles.
Practical tip: build small projects that show test plans, bug reports, and automation scripts. That concrete experience matters most when companies evaluate candidates for entry-level testing jobs.
IT Support and Infrastructure
A help-desk Tier 1 position is often the fastest way to collect real-world experience fixing computer and network issues. These jobs put you on the front line of service, handling basic hardware, software, and connection problems that employees or customers face.
NOC technicians monitor critical systems and respond to alerts in real time. You learn to triage outages, escalate when needed, and document incidents so teams can restore service quickly.
Earn practical credentials like CompTIA A+ or the Google IT Support Professional Certificate to validate foundational knowledge. Certifications pair well with short projects that showcase troubleshooting skills and calm problem solving.
These roles teach the technical skills and communication habits employers value. You will explain fixes to non-technical people, log support tickets clearly, and use resources to resolve issues faster.
Why this matters: help-desk and NOC work supply the hands-on systems experience that leads to network administration, systems engineering, or other higher-level jobs. Treat each ticket as a learning project and build a portfolio that proves your range.
